Vikings Shoot Down Jets

Kirk Cousins threw two touchdown passes, Latavius Murray ran for two scores, and the Vikings (4-2-1) pulled away in the second half for a 37-17 victory over the New York Jets.

It wasn’t the best performance of the season by the Vikings’ high-powered offense, but it was certainly good enough against a Jets team that had four turnovers — including interceptions by Harrison Smith, Holton Hill and Trae Waynes.

Vikings wide receiver Adam Thielen became the fifth player in NFL history to get at least 100 yards receiving in seven consecutive games, catching nine passes for 110 yards and a touchdown.

He and Charley Hennigan(1961) are the only players to do so in his team’s first seven games to open the season.
